LS221 coating thickness gauge is also called coating thickness meter and paint thickness meter. It is a professional instrument for measuring the thickness of metal surface coatings. The host and the probe adopt a separate design, which is convenient for viewing data while testing under complex test conditions. It can be used in the laboratory and engineering field.

Hall effect: can be used for the measurement of non-ferromagnetic coatings on ferromagnetic metal substrates.
Eddy current: can be used for the measurement of non-conductive coatings on non-magnetic metal substrates.
Parameter | LS221 Coating Thickness Gauge |
Probe tip | Ruby fixed |
Measuring principle | Fe:Hall Effect / NFe: Eddy current |
Probe type | External cable probe |
Measuring rang | 0.0-2000μm |
Resolution | 0.1μm:(0μm -99.9μm) 1μm:(100μm-999μm) 0.01mm:(1.00mm-2.00mm) |
Accuracy | ≤±(3% reading+2μm) |
Unit | μm / mil |
Measuring interval | 0.5s |
Minimum measuring area | Ø =25mm |
Minimum curvature | Convex:5mm / Concave:25mm |
Minimum substrate thickness | Fe:0.2mm / NFe:0.05mm |
Display | 128×48 dot matrix LCD |
Power supply | 2pcs of 1.5V AAA alkaline battery |
Range of operation temperature | 0℃-50℃ |
Storage temperature range | -20℃-60℃ |
Host size | 101*62*28 mm |
Probe size | 71*26*22 mm |
Weight(with battery) | 114 g |
